Average Brand Ambassador Salary in East Timor for 2026

A brand ambassador in East Timor earns about 37,800 USD a year. That's 47% above the national average of 25,720 USD.

Pay ranges widely from country to country and from role to role. The lowest reported salaries in East Timor sit around 19,380 USD a year, while the very top stretches to 57,620 USD. Everything on this page is in United States dollar (USD, symbol $), which lets you compare numbers like-for-like without worrying about exchange rates.

The numbers here are pulled together from official government wage data, large independent salary surveys, and aggregated worker-reported pay. Most reported salaries include the benefits that are common in East Timor, such as housing or transport allowances, which is worth keeping in mind if you're comparing against a country where those are usually paid on top.

How brand ambassador pay ranges in East Timor

A good way to think about salary in East Timor is to look at the distribution rather than the headline average. Half of all brand ambassadors in East Timor earn less than 37,620 USD a year, and the other half earn more. That middle number is the median, and it is usually more useful than the average for answering "is my pay normal here".

Looking at the quartiles fills in the picture. A quarter of earners take home less than 25,940 USD (the 25th percentile), and a quarter clear 45,600 USD (the 75th percentile). The middle 50% of brand ambassadors sit somewhere inside that band, which is where the typical reader of this page probably lives.

The very lowest reported salaries sit around 19,380 USD. The highest stretch to 57,620 USD, though only a small fraction of earners ever reach that level. If you are deciding whether your own offer or current pay is reasonable, work out which of those four bands you would fall into and use that as your reference point.

Brand ambassador pay by experience in East Timor

Years of experience is the single biggest lever on pay for a brand ambassador in East Timor, ahead of education and almost any other single factor. The longer you have been in the role, the more your employer can trust you to handle complexity, mentor others and act independently, all of which command higher pay. The chart below shows how the typical brand ambassador salary changes as you move through the career ladder.

  • 0-2 Years
    23,500 USD
  • 2-5 Years
    +17% from previous
    27,480 USD
  • 5-10 Years
    +41% from previous
    38,780 USD
  • 10-15 Years
    +18% from previous
    45,720 USD
  • 15-20 Years
    +17% from previous
    53,600 USD
  • 20+ Years
    +3% from previous
    55,020 USD

The single largest jump on the ladder is from 2 - 5 Years to 5 - 10 Years, where pay rises by about 41%. That is the point at which a brand ambassador typically goes from "competent in the role" to "the person other people in the team learn from", and the market pays well for that step.

Brand ambassador gender pay gap in East Timor

The gender pay gap is a stubborn feature of almost every labour market, and East Timor is no exception. Male brand ambassadors in East Timor earn an average of 38,340 USD a year, while female brand ambassadors earn around 37,620 USD. That works out to a 2% gap in favour of men, even when comparing people doing the same work.

A pay gap of this size has a real long-term cost. Over a typical thirty-year career it can add up to several years of pay, and it compounds through pensions, retirement contributions and bonus-linked stock. Some of the gap is explained by women being more likely to work part-time, take career breaks, or be steered toward lower-paying specialisations. Some of it is straightforward unequal pay for the same job, which is harder to defend.

Brand ambassador bonus rates in East Timor

Bonuses are the other half of total compensation, and they vary a lot between jobs and industries. Some roles are paid almost entirely in base salary; others lean heavily on bonus structures tied to revenue, project completion or company performance. Whether a job pays a bonus, how big it is, and how often it lands all factor into whether the headline salary is actually a good offer.

60%

60% of brand ambassadors in East Timor reported a bonus of some kind in the past twelve months. That makes a brand ambassador a moderate-bonus role overall, which is useful context when you're weighing up a job offer where the base is below market.

Among those who did receive a bonus, the size of the payment varied substantially. Reported bonuses ranged from 6% to 8% of base salary. The remaining 40% of brand ambassadors reported no bonus at all over the same period.
